Отсутствует MSVCP110.dll или MSVCR110.dll в Windows 10/7
Как вы можете видеть MSVCP110.dll и MSVCR110.dll это два почти одинаковых файла, но разные окончания. Исправления этой ошибки будет одинаковое. MSVCR110.dll или MSVCP110.dll — это одна из библиотек разработанная для программ или игр с помощью Visual Studio 2011/12.
Если этот файл будет отсутствовать или поврежден в системе Windows 10, то при запуске программ или игр вы увидите сообщение об ошибке «Запуск программы невозможен, так как на компьютере отсутствует MSVCP110.dll или MSVCR110.dll. Попробуйте переустановить программу«. Наверняка вы захотите просто скачать отдельный файл и скопировать его к себе, чтобы решить ошибку.
Настоятельно рекомендую не скачивать dll-файлы со сторонних источников на веб-сайтах. Решение этой проблемы очень простое и можно скачать оригинальную dll библиотеку, и даже отдельно. Давайте и разберем, как исправить ошибку, когда MSVCP110.dll, MSVCR110.dll отсутствует или поврежден в Windows 10.
Как исправить ошибку : «Отсутствует msvcp110.dll»
Скачать MSVCP110.dll или MSVCR110.dll для Windows 10
- https://www.microsoft.com/ru-ru/download/details.aspx?id=30679.
- При нажатии скачать, вам нужно выбрать VSU4vcredist_x64.exe или VSU4vcredist_x86.exe.
Для 32-ух битной системы вы выбираете x86. Если у вас система 64-bit, то рекомендую установить x64 и x86, так как старые программы могут использовать старые библиотеки 32-bit.
Способ 2. Если у вас нет интернета и вы не можете скачать оригинальный файл MSVCP110.dll или MSVCR110.dll, то разумным решением будет взять его и скопировать к себе в систему, но брать мы будем безопасный файл. Вы можете взять этот файл с другого ПК или ноутбука, записать его на флешку, и скопировать к себе. Также, у многих пользователей есть папка C:Windows.old. Эта папка старой Windows и в ней вы можете поискать файл.
Куда кидать и путь файла MSVCP110.dll или MSVCR110.dll:
В некоторых случаях, когда вы скопировали к себе файл из другого ПК, то его нужно зарегистрировать. Это легко. Откройте командную строку от имени администратора и введите regsvr32, путь и имя dll-файла.
Ошибка: «Отсутствует msvcp110.dll»»Отсутствует msvcp120.dll»»Отсутствует msvcp140.dll»
Регистрация файла MSVCP110.dll:
- ecли система 32-Bit — regsvr32 C:windowssystem32msvcp110.dll
- ecли система 64Bit — regsvr32 C:windowsSysWOW64msvcp110.dll
Регистрация файла MSVCR110.dll:
- ecли система 32-Bit — regsvr32 C:windowssystem32msvcr110.dll
- ecли система 64Bit — regsvr32 C:windowsSysWOW64msvcr110.dll
Если вы закинули к себе два файла в SysWOW64 и System32, то нужно регистрировать по двум этим путям. Регистрация dll файлов не всегда бывает удачна.
Способ 3. Этот способ поможет вам, если эта библиотека повреждена. Воспользуемся встроенными средствами по автоматическому восстановлению системных файлов. Запустите командную строку от имени администратора и введите команды ниже, дожидаясь окончание процесса после каждой команды.
msvcp110.dll
При запуске Battlefield 4, новых версий Need for Speed и других игрушек, встречается ошибка «на компьютере отсутствует msvcp110.dll». Значит на компьютере нет одной из библиотек, которую использовали при создании игры. Msvcp110.dll – один из файлов Microsoft Visual C++. С этой библиотекой часто бывают проблемы, особенно, если устанавливать нелицензионные версии игр.
Приложение, скачанное с торрентов, может заменить msvcp110.dll при установке, в результате чего перестанут работать даже официальные игры и программы. Также файл может быть удалён пользователем или антивирусом.
Если у вас появилась эта ошибка, её можно исправить. Для этого надо:
Первым делом вам нужно узнать версию своей операционной системы и её разрядность. Эти данные можно найти в Панель управления->Система. Обратите внимание на версию Windows и на графу «Тип системы», где написана разрядность операционки. Если у вас XP или Windows 7 старой версии, то вам нужно скачать Microsoft Visual C++ 2010.
Если Windows 7 SP1, Windows 8 или десятка, то понадобится пакет Visual C++ 2012, не забывайте о разрядности. Скачивать пакет лучше с официального сайта Microsoft, это бесплатно. После установки Visual C++ ошибка «отсутствует msvcp110.dll» пропадёт.
Что делать, если вы переустановили библиотеки C++, а запуск программы невозможен? Придётся скачать файл msvcp110.dll и положить в системную папку. Место, куда кидать файл, зависит от разрядности Windows, если у вас 32-х битная версия, то это System32 в корневой папке Windows, в 64-х разрядной системе — SysWOW64. Библиотеку msvcp110.dll скачать для Windows 7/8/10 вы сможете у нас. После регистрации файла перезагрузите компьютер, всё должно заработать.
Рекомендуем в первую очередь, скачать и установить полностью пакет Microsoft Visual C++ 2012. Ошибка должна сразу исчезнуть.
Как установить DLL файл вы можете прочитать на страницы, в которой максимально подробно описан данный процесс.
Отсутствует файл msvcp110.dll. Что это за ошибка как исправить
Отсуствует msvcr110.dll? Разберемся что за ошибка и как исправить!
Доброго времени суток! Если Вы после установки новой программы или современной игры (к примеру, Watch Dogs 2 или другой игры или софта) не смогли её запустить, потому что система выдаёт ошибку. А в диалоговом окне программа пишет страшное сообщение «что запуск программы невозможен, так как на компьютере отсутствует msvcr110.dll. Попробуйте переустановить программу». На которую стоит обратить внимание.
Это сообщение об ошибке часто выскакивает при запуске программ или игр написанных на языке программирования Visual Studio. А говорит сообщение об отсутствии указанного файла в системе или о его повреждении. Что делать? Главное – не расстраиваться, потому как всякая проблема решаема! В сегодняшней заметке мы с вами проанализируем msvcr110.dll что это за ошибка как исправить, и разберём причины её появления.
В заметке расскажу как ее можно исправить самостоятельно, не прибегая к ИТшникам, двумя проверенными способами. Дам прямые ссылки, где можно скачать файл msvcr110.dll, и куда кидать в систему.
Для начала я расскажу, что представляет собой этот файл и каково его предназначение в системе. Если Вам это не интересно, переходите сразу к решениям.
ошибка msvcr110.dll — причины появления
Если говорить на простом языке, то файл msvcr110 является частью библиотеки, входящей в пакет Microsoft Visual C++ 2012. Этот пакет необходим для запуска современных игр и ПО, написанных на языке C++, а находящиеся в нём библиотеки DLL нужны для корректной работы.
Причины, которые могли вызвать ошибку msvcr110 на ПК, могут быть разными:
- Нужная библиотека отсутствует в составе Microsoft Visual C++, или распространяемый пакет от майкрософт не установлен вовсе.
- Файл msvcr110 был поражён вирусом или случайно удалён пользователем (Такое случается когда файл, удаляется вместе с другим софтом)
- Проблемный софт был изначально некорректно установлен (Если в составе установки не присутствует пакет Visual C++ нужной версии, содержащий набор dll)
Как исправить ошибку msvcr110.dll
Вследствие того, что msvcr110 является лишь частью большой библиотеки, то ручное добавление его на компьютер, не всегда может исправить ошибку. Некоторые программы будут требовать следующие файлы из библиотеки, а они также повреждены или отсутствуют. Длиться это может долго. Я писал в своих заметках про подобные недостающие файлы msvcr120, msvcp110 и т.д.
Ещё скажу, что копирования msvcr110 в требуемую папку также, иногда будет недостаточно. Потребуется его регистрация в системе. Куда нужно копировать файл и процесс регистрации файла msvcr110.dll я расскажу подробно.
Вариантов решения два. Выбирайте, который Вам больше по душе, или проще в исполнении. Если вам не помог первый способ, то пробуйте применить второй.
В большинстве случаев устранить ошибку msvcr110.dll получается установкой или переустановкой Visual C++ 2012
Устанавливаем Microsoft Visual C++ 2012
Наиболее простой метод решения ошибки msvcr110.dll – установка нового пакета Microsoft Visual C++ 2012, чем мы сейчас и займемся. Это абсолютно бесплатно и займёт не больше пяти минут.
Нередко случается так, что данный пакет уже установлен на ПК. Проверить это можно в панели управления, открыв «Программы и компоненты». Если Visual C++ 2012 у вас уже имеется, то старую версию необходимо удалить и установить новую.
Скачивать пакет Visual C++ 2013 рекомендуется с официального сайта компании Майкрософт. Для этого пройдите по ссылке ниже, выберите «Русский» язык, а после кликните по кнопке «Скачать». Как на картинке ниже.
Скачать Msvcr110.dll с официального сайта Microsoft
Далее вам нужно будет установить галочку возле тех файлов, которые необходимо скачать. Выбор здесь зависит от разрядности используемой вами ОС Windows.
Для ОС версии 64 bit нужен файл с названием: vcredist_x64.exe.
После выбора нужных файлов кликните по кнопке «Next» . Начнётся их автоматическая загрузка. Затем скачанные файлы устанавливаются на ПК – процедура аналогична установке любого софта и проходит в два клика. После инсталляции пакета Microsoft Visual C++ компьютер необходимо перезагрузить.
Что делать, если система всё равно пишет, что «Запуск программы невозможен, так как на вашем компьютере отсутствует msvcr110.dll»? Тогда попробуйте воспользоваться вторым методом.
Скачиваем недостающий файл msvcr110.dll в ручную
Если установка распространяемого пакета Microsoft Visual C++ 2012 не исправила ошибку, то надо установить msvcr110.dll на свой компьютер вручную. Для Windows 7, 8, 10 файл msvcr110.dll скачать можно по ссылке ниже.
Дальше распакуйте скачанный архив и скопируйте файл в системную директорию.
На сайте вы найдёте msvcr110 разных версий. Здесь, так же необходимо выбрать вариант в соответствии с разрядностью вашей операционной системы. Чтобы облегчить вам задачу ниже я указал прямые ссылки на скачивание.
Теперь давайте разберемся куда кидать msvcr100.dll в систему:
Для Windows x64 копируете в папку C:WindowsSysWOW64
Иногда помогает копировать в обе папки сразу.
После копирования файл нужно зарегистрировать в системе. Для этого вызовите команду «Выполнить…» одновременным нажатием клавиш Win + R . В ней пишите regsvr32 MSVCR110.dll и нажмите значок Ok .
А лучше всего зарегистрировать файл, через командную строку с правами администратора:
если система 32Bit — regsvr32 C:windowssystem32msvcr110.dll
если система 64Bit — regsvr32 C:windowsSysWOW64msvcr110.dll
После перезагрузки ПК ошибка больше возникать не должна.
Подведем итог — Как исправить ошибку msvcr110.dll
На компьютере отсутствует MSVCP110.dll: что делать? Восстанавливаем динамические библиотеки за 10 минут
Сегодня поговорим об одной из самых распространённых ошибок, возникающих при установке и запуске новых программ в Windows. В данном случае приложение не открывается вообще, а на экране появляется оповещение о системной ошибки. Причина — на компьютере отсутствует MSVCP110.dll. Что делать и как решить проблему?
Поможет ли переустановка?
В качестве решения сама система предлагает попробовать переустановить программу. Однако, как показывает практика, это лишь бесполезная трата времени. Даже после переустановки вы увидите на экране то же сообщение.
Почему на самом деле возникает ошибка
Теперь немного теории. Вместе с Windows на компьютер по умолчанию устанавливаются и динамические библиотеки — те самые файлы с расширением .dll. Именно они отвечают за нормальное воспроизведение и работу практически всех программ, особенно игр.
Нетрудно понять, что значит «Отсутствует MSVCP110.Dll». По какой-то причине данный файл не был записан при установке Windows. Другой вариант — он есть на жёстком диске, однако система не может его обнаружить.
Итак, у вас на компьютере отсутствует MSVCP110.Dll. Что делать? В обоих случаях решение одно — скачать и добавить недостающий файл в систему. Это может сделать двумя способами.
Способ #1: установка MSVCP110.dll вручную
Самый простой вариант — найти и скачать данный файл, а затем вручную добавить и зарегистрировать его в системе. После этого вы перестанете видеть сообщение о том, что на компьютере отсутствует MSVCP110.dll. Что делать?
- Войдите в Windows через аккаунт администратора.
- Скачайте файл MSVCP110.dll в папку System32 (для 64-хразрядных версий — SysWOW64) в директории Windows.
- Нажмите Win+R, чтобы запустить приложение «Выполнить».
- Впишите в строку следующий текст:
Если команда не работает, можно попробовать ввести «regsvr32». После этого нажмите «ОК» и перезагрузите компьютер. Если всё получилось, ошибка не будет возникать, и нужное приложение откроется без проблем.
Способ #2: установка полного пакета библиотек
Как правило, сообщение о том, что запуск программы невозможен, говорит о том, что динамические библиотеки в системе отсутствуют вообще. Даже если вы установите один конкретный файл, будут возникать новые ошибки. Лучше решить эту проблему сразу и установить все компоненты, необходимые для нормальной работы Windows:
- DirectX — набор программных модулей для обработки 2D и 3D-изображений.
- Новые драйверы для видеокарты. Чтобы система автоматически нашла и установила их, зайдите в «Диспетчер устройств» > «Видеоадаптеры». В выпадающем списке выберите свою видеокарту, кликните правой кнопкой и выберите пункт «Обновить драйверы». Можно выбрать автоматический поиск, установить файлы с диска или предварительно скачать из Интернета.
- .NET Framework — платформа, поддерживающая работу практически всех продуктов Mircosoft, а также других приложений и игр.
- Microsoft Visual C++ — те самые библиотеки, которые нужны для запуска нового ПО.
Чтобы установить все компоненты, потребуется не более 30 минут, зато потом у вас не будет возникать никаких проблем при установке программ.
Полезные советы
1) Перед установкой временно отключите антивирусное ПО — оно может по ошибке посчитать нужные файлы вредоносными и заблокировать их. Скачивать любые компоненты нужно только с проверенных источников, а лучше всего — с официального сайта Microsoft.
2) Чтобы узнать разрядность (32 или 64-х), откройте «Свойства» компьютера и посмотрите, что написано в строке «Тип системы». В Windows 10 можно просто ввести в поиске «Этот компьютер».
3) В редких случаях даже после вышеперечисленных действий продолжает появляться уведомление «На компьютере отсутствует MSVCP110.dll». Что делать в этом случае? Скорее всего, вы используете «ломаный» Windows, причём неработоспособный. Выход один — переустановка системы (кстати, при установке нормальной системы файлы библиотек, скорее всего, будут добавлены автоматически).
Источник: fb.ru
Как исправить ошибку msvcp110.dll: установка библиотеки
Добро пожаловать на наш наидобрейший WiFiGid! Скорее всего вы установили какую-то новую модную игрушку (ну или не совсем новую, или не совсем модную), а при запуске получили сообщение от Windows о том, что система не обнаружила msvcp110.dll? Ничего страшного, игра не побита, а на вашем компьютере всего лишь не хватает одной библиотеки (отсутствует тот самый файл msvcp110.dll). В этой статье предлагаю узнать, что нужно делать, и очень быстро исправить эту проблему.
Эта статья написана для актуальных операционных систем – Windows 10 и Windows 11. Всем остальным – уверен, вы справитесь
Способ 1 – Microsoft Visual C++
Указанная в ошибке библиотека msvcp110.dll входит в состав пакета Microsoft Visual C++. Поэтому и решение будет простым – просто идем на их сайт, скачиваем, устанавливаем, радуемся. Поехали?
- Переходим на официальный сайт .
- Листаем страничку чуть в низ и находим там две версии – для x86 и для x X64 – для 64-разрядной Windows, а x86 – для 32-разрядной. Скачиваем нужное для своей системы.
А лучше скачать оба пакета. Для 64-битной системы уже точно встречал ошибки, когда не был установлен пакет x86.
- Устанавливаем, перезагружаем компьютер и пытаемся запустить свою игру. Уверен, что в 99% случаев именно ошибка, связанная с msvcpdll исчезнет. Возможно, появятся какие-то другие, но решения для них скорее следует искать уже в других наших статьях.
Обычно на современном компьютере, если посмотреть список установленных программ, уже установлены пакеты Microsoft Visual C++. Причем как раз обычно их несколько. Вполне себе допустимо перед установкой нового попытаться удалить все старые версии, т.к. сам себя он почему-то не удаляет и продолжает плодить мусор в списке программ.
Способ 2 – Про установку напрямую
Конечно, можно скачать эту библиотеку напрямую и поместить ее по правильному пути. Но не рекомендую заниматься такими мероприятиями. Во-первых, есть вариант подцепить какую-нибудь заразу. Во-вторых, так вы решите только проблему с этой библиотекой, а если там недостает чего-то еще, придется искать дальше. В-третьих, гораздо удобнее и быстрее установить сразу официальный пакет один раз и больше не пудрить себе мозги.
Но если вы вдруг очень-очень хотите:
- Ищем компьютер-донор, где уже установлена эта библиотека (вот не буду давать ссылки на скачивания, вполне может быть опасно).
- Идем по следующим путям:
C:WindowsSystem32 (x86 версия)
C:WindowsSysWOW64 (x64 версия)
- Копируем оттуда на свой компьютер по этим же путям файл msvcpdll (это две разные версии файла, поэтому их и нужно перекидывать в разные места, хотя и название у них одинаковое).
На всякий случай
Просто оставляю свои мысли здесь, а вдруг кому-то помогут:
- Ошибка связана исключительно с файлом msvcpdll – других вариантов быть не может, и этот файл находится исключительно в Microsoft Visual C++.
- После установки просто попробуйте перезагрузить компьютер, чтоб Windows наверняка обновила все списки установленных библиотек.
- Проверьте папку с игрой, чтобы в ней не было уже никаких других msvcpdll. Если найдете – удаляйте.
- Нашли новое решение? Обязательно напишите об этом в комментариях, так вы можете помочь нашим многим читателям.
- И если вчера все работало нормально, а сегодня вылезла ошибка (и даже после обновления Windows) – решение остается тем же самым: скачиваем, устанавливаем, радуемся.
Источник: wifigid.ru